Bonuses and Promotions — Tempting but Technical
Madjoker greets new players with a welcome bonus that looks generous on paper, but the fine print is where your expectations need to be adjusted. The wagering requirements are steep, and not all games contribute equally to clearing them. Slots usually count 100%, while table games contribute far less — often just 10% or even 5%. This means if you plan to play blackjack with your bonus, you are in for a long, frustrating grind. The weekly reload bonuses and free spin offers are nice perks, but they come with similar restrictions. My advice: always read the terms before you hit “claim.” A bonus that locks you into a cycle of heavy play is not a gift; it is a contract.

Payment Methods and Withdrawal Speed
Funding your account is straightforward. Debit cards, e-wallets like Skrill and Neteller, and even some cryptocurrencies are accepted. Deposits are instant, which is standard. The real test, however, comes when you want to cash out. Withdrawals to e-wallets typically process within 24 hours, which is acceptable. But bank transfers and card withdrawals can take anywhere from three to five working days. The first withdrawal also requires a full identity verification — this is normal for licensed casinos, but it can be a bottleneck if you rush to cash out without submitting your documents early. There are no hidden fees, which is a positive, but the pending period can test your patience.
